π What is Kivy?
Kivy is an open-source Python framework used for building cross-platform mobile and desktop applications using a single codebase.
Kivy helps developers create applications for:
- Android
- iOS
- Windows
- macOS
- Linux
using Python programming.
Kivy is widely used for creating:
- Mobile applications
- Desktop applications
- Touch-enabled applications
- IoT dashboards
- Educational apps
- Prototype applications
It helps developers:
- Build mobile applications using Python
- Create cross-platform apps
- Develop graphical user interfaces (GUI)
- Build touch-based applications
- Integrate APIs & backend systems
- Develop real-time applications
Popular technologies used with Kivy:
- Python
- KivyMD (Material Design)
- SQLite
- REST APIs
- Firebase
- OpenCV
- NumPy
- Machine Learning Integration
In simple words:
Kivy helps Python developers build Android and iPhone mobile applications without learning Java, Swift, or Kotlin.
